Using Van Gogh's letters as a primary source, the author discusses the artist's life, his approach to his work, and his mental illness. The letters vividly show the artist's life was no bed of roses. Whereas Van Gogh perfectly knew what was sellable, he continued to produce what he considered as honest, truthful art, regardless of current taste. He did not expect the art-buying public to understand the rough appearance of his work. Van Gogh acknowledged that being an artist simply involved struggle, but he believed that one would benefit from adversity, both personally and professionally. "No victory without a battle, no battle without suffering." In Van Gogh's case, it seems to have been a never-ending battle against poverty, isolation, and adversity. Given his circumstances - being financially dependent upon his brother Theo, not selling any work, and getting minimal recognition - his achievements are utterly amazing. (Samuel Beckett, Joyces friend and secretary, about Finnegans Wake) James Joyce is the high priest of modernist writing who lived a life of endless sacrifice to literature, loaded with poverty and petty humiliations. He blazed the path of the writer as resolute individualist, rejecting all conformity and risking everything, even public shaming, in order to "communicate" over the supine body of language with his enthralled readers. He once remarked to his younger brother Stanislaus, Dont you think there is a certain resemblance between the mystery of the Mass and what I am trying to do? I mean that I am trying...to give people some kind of intellectual pleasure or spiritual enjoyment by converting the bread of everyday life into something that has a permanent artistic life of its own...for their mental, moral, and spiritual uplift. Joyce pioneered modern literature through his use of stream of consciousness, a literary technique that lets readers get straight into the mind of the books characters and stands in stark contrast to Ernest Hemingway's "iceberg" style of leaving things to the readers' imaginations. In his masterpiece Ulysses, Joyce explores several topics and thoughts that go through the mind of one man in Dublin for a day, and he also wrote other critically-acclaimed works such as the short-story collection Dubliners (1914), and the novels A Portrait of the Artist as a Young Man (1916) and Finnegans Wake (1939). He said of his frequent use of Dublin as a setting, "For myself, I always write about Dublin, because if I can get to the heart of Dublin I can get to the heart of all the cities of the world. As the originator of the first sentient robot in literature ("I, Robot," published in Amazing Stories in 1939 and predating Isaac Asimov's collection of the same name), Binder's effect on science fiction was profound. Within the world of comic books, he created or cocreated much of the Superman universe, including Smallville; Krypto, Superboy's dog; Supergirl; and the villain Braniac. Binder is also credited with writing many of the first "Bizarro" storylines for DC Comics as well as for being the main writer for the Captain Marvel comics. In later years Binder expanded from comic books into pure science writing, publishing dozens of books and articles on the subject of satellites and space travel as well as UFOs and extraterrestrial life. Title: Rainer Maria Rilke: A Biography Author: Allison Broadway Narrator: Jonathan Dauermann Format: Unabridged Length: 20 mins Language: English Release date: 06-13-17 Publisher: Allison Broadway Ratings: 3.5 of 5 out of 3 votes Genres: Bios & Memoirs, Artists, Writers, & Musicians Publisher's Summary: Rainer Maria Rilke was a Bohemian Austrian poet and novelist, "widely recognized as one of the most lyrically intense German-language poets", writing in both verse and highly lyrical prose. Several critics have described Rilke's work as inherently "mystical". His writings include one novel, several collections of poetry, and several volumes of correspondence in which he invokes haunting images that focus on the difficulty of communion with the ineffable in an age of disbelief, solitude, and profound anxiety. These deeply existential themes tend to position him as a transitional figure between the traditional and the modernist writers. Rilke was born in the Austro-Hungarian Empire; travelled extensively throughout Europe, including Russia, Spain, Germany, France, and Italy; and in his later years settled in Switzerland - settings that were key to the genesis and inspiration for many of his poems.

Eager to find his way in life and words, John Dos Passos first witnessed the horror of trench warfare in France as a volunteer ambulance driver retrieving the dead and seriously wounded from the front line. Later in the war, he briefly met another young writer, Ernest Hemingway, who was just arriving for his service in the ambulance corps. When the war was over, both men knew they had to write about it; they had to give voice to what they felt about war and life. Their friendship and collaboration developed through the peace of the 1920s and 1930s, as Hemingway's novels soared to success while Dos Passos penned the greatest antiwar novel of his generation, Three Soldiers. In war Hemingway found adventure, women, and a cause. Dos Passos saw only oppression and futility. Their different visions eventually turned their private friendship into a bitter public fight fueled by money, jealousy, and lust.
